The effect of Pentoxifylline on blood lactate levels in newborns with asphyxia

The efficacy of Pentoxifylline compared with placebo on serum lactate levels in newborns with asphyxia treated with hypothermia

Conditions

Hypoxic ischemic encephalopathy. Hypoxic ischemic encephalopathy [HIE]

Interventions

Intervention 1: Intervention group: newborns in the intervention group receive a single dose of Pentoxifylline at 5 mg/kg administered via gavage before initiation of therapeutic hypothermia. A 400 mg

Inclusion criteria

Inclusion criteria: Gestational age = 36 weeks Birth weight = 1800 g Diagnosis of neonatal asphyxia grade II or III Diagnosis of moderate to severe hypoxic-ischemic encephalopathy (HIE) Ability to initiate therapeutic hypothermia within = 6 hours after birth

Exclusion criteria

Exclusion criteria: Presence of major congenital anomalies or known genetic syndromes Confirmed severe systemic infection Evidence of multi-organ failure at the time of study enrollment

Design outcomes

Primary

MeasureTime frame
Serum lactate level. Timepoint: Baseline (before intervention), 12 hours, 24 hours, 48 hours, and 72 hours after initiation of therapeutic hypothermia. Method of measurement: Single Molecule Array (Simoa).

Secondary

MeasureTime frame
Neurodevelopmental outcomes. Timepoint: Neurodevelopmental assessment at 1 month of age; neurological changes and adverse events monitored from baseline until hospital discharge. Method of measurement: Bayley Scales of Infant and Toddler Development, Third Edition, and neurological changes including Sarnat score and amplitude integrated electroencephalography (aEEG).
